Foreign Cinema celebrated its 20-year anniversary with a big celebration that brought out magicians, acrobats and a spank booth inspired by the films of Federico Fellini for guests to gawk and interact with. Co-owner John Clark said they sold 350 tickets and were able to raise $35,000 that would be donated to three charities: 826 Valencia, the Mission Neighborhood Center and the Sisters of Perpetual Indulgence.

Reporter Julian Mark walks us through their birthday bash and asks guests: What were you like when you were 20 years old?
